Why visit?

Bowling Green, located in the beautiful state of Kentucky, offers a unique blend of history, nature, and culture, making it an exciting destination for tourists. Here are some reasons to visit Bowling Green:

Lost River Cave: Explore the underground wonderland and take a boat tour through the largest natural cave entrance in the Eastern United States.

National Corvette Museum: Car enthusiasts will be thrilled to visit this museum dedicated to the iconic American sports car. Marvel at the impressive collection and even witness the infamous sinkhole where some of the cars fell in 2014.

Historic Railpark and Train Museum: Immerse yourself in the history of railroads and experience an authentic train ride at this fascinating museum.

Beech Bend Park: Enjoy thrilling amusement park rides, cool off at the water park, and catch exciting live entertainment at this family-friendly park.

Aviation Heritage Park: Discover the rich aviation history of Bowling Green with a visit to this park featuring impressive aircraft displays and interactive exhibits.
